> >  > To use eloader you need to be able to start up in OS9.  Opening
> >Classic while OSx is
> >  > running won't work.  You'll also need the OPCODE OMS app.  If I
> >remember correctly, it's
> >>  on the emu cd along with the eloader app. 
> >>
> >>  I've had to keep my old iMac around just for the emu/elaoder.  My
> >new Powerbook won't
> >>  start up in OS9.
